The film starts with a linear narrative, explaining the background of Moses' survival.

When Moses grows up (will definitely) discover his own life experience, here the opening plot is restored through murals, which will not be repeated in form, and ensure the coherence of the plot.

The 2D element of the mural itself, as one of the symbols of wisdom in ancient Egypt, is more flexible and not obtrusive when used in 2D animation. [Turn] Moses' self-identification and decision to lead the liberation of his own people.

The plot of this section does not show the big scene of the ancient battlefield, but uses the will of "God".

The lens language is rich, and here is one that I like very much. The buildings that were originally neat and low are displayed in a well-ordered manner by panning the camera up and down. In the same way, the long shot of the old pharaoh's construction of a portrait contains both height and depth, and the scale is huge and the project is complex.
